Anahit Bashir (Aeon, as he likes to be called) is a seventh grader at Stanford Online High School. He started his cello journey at age four and currently studies with Dr. David Holmes and Teresa Richardson. Aeon is a member of the Minnesota Youth Symphonies Orchestra and has won awards in several competitions including the Crescendo International Competition, Elite International Music Competition, Golden Classical Competition, Mary West Competition, and the American Protégé Competition. He has had the honor of performing at Carnegie Hall, and also enjoys music composition and piano. Aside from music, Aeon loves traveling, reading and playing tennis.
